Dorianmode,

Something interrupted the Data Centre Convert process (perhaps there was a note about it in the Progress window?)

The Download succeeded but the Convert did not. Simply rerun the Convert Task on the cards which appear incomplete (check Convert, uncheck Download) and uncheck Don't Duplicate - i.e. do permit the Data Centre to duplicate the Convert process it already did (incompletely) on those cards. If you don't uncheck Don't Duplicate, the previous Convert of the card in question will not be ... Duplicated. (Return the check-marks to their original settings when you're done).

Problem resolved, as follows:

1. You have to also install the RDSS software. Either before or after installing the Demo Database, but the software itself must be installed. The Database install program is not the RDSS software, nor does it install the software - it is only a big database to play with. (it has a separate installer program as it is a very large download file and not everyone wants all those old races).

2. Install the Demo database (http://www.sartinmethodology.com/rdss-demo-database).

3. Follow the instructions to modify the RDSS Configuration file (http://www.sartinmethodology.com/rdss-demo-database). If you don't do that, you will get the default database - the blank empty database, and not the 5000+ races of the 2010 Demo Database.
